Long Bottom Leaf May 19, 2018 @ 10:39pm 
Originally posted by 12magic:
however sylvans were an error

Nah Konami adding card packs at least twice a month along with events is kinda the problem. Way too many cards too quick so people dont have time to experiment and flesh out other decks. Why spend a month making Insect Beater good when you can just play Sylvans.

That and Konami have been adding archtypes practically completed, so there is no need to "work" on a solid deck of that archtype. All the cards necessary are already in the game. Imagine if Sylvans were spread out over 2-3 packs. The player would actually have to make decisions on what ressources to put into a deck with what is available. Genuinely surprised there have been any nerfs/banns at all honestly
